Git 是现代软件开发中不可或缺的版本控制工具,掌握其核心功能和高效工作流能极大提升开发效率。理解 Git 的基本概念是入门的第一步,包括仓库、提交、分支和远程仓库等。
在日常使用中,合理管理分支是提高协作效率的关键。通常建议使用主分支(如 main 或 master)进行稳定代码的维护,而开发新功能时应创建独立的特性分支,避免直接在主分支上修改。
提交信息的规范性同样重要。清晰、简洁的提交信息有助于团队成员快速了解每次更改的目的,推荐遵循类似 “类型: 说明” 的格式,例如 feat: 添加用户登录功能。
掌握合并与变基操作的区别,能够避免不必要的冲突和混乱。合并保留完整历史记录,适合团队协作;变基则使提交历史更线性,适合个人开发流程。
使用 Git 钩子(hooks)可以自动化执行脚本,如代码检查或部署任务,提升开发流程的可靠性。同时,定期清理无用的远程分支,保持仓库整洁。
AI绘图结果,仅供参考
•熟悉常用命令如 git status、git diff、git log 和 git blame 能显著提高操作效率。结合图形化工具(如 VS Code 内置 Git 功能),可进一步简化日常操作。